Internet of Things (IoT) has revolutionized the way we interact with our environments, connecting billions of devices to enhance efficiency, convenience, and automation in various sectors such as healthcare, transportation, and smart homes. However, the proliferation of interconnected devices also introduces significant security challenges. IoT devices, often designed with limited computing resources, may lack robust security features, making them vulnerable to cyber-attacks. As IoT continues to expand, discovering and addressing its security vulnerabilities becomes paramount to safeguarding personal privacy and ensuring the resilience of interconnected infrastructures. This project showcase will introduce and demonstrate current capabilities of the OWASP IoT Security Testing Guide (ISTG) project released earlier this year. The ISTG comprises a comprehensive methodology for penetration tests in the IoT field, offering flexibility to adapt innovations, and developments in the IoT market while still ensuring comparability of test results. While the guide is mainly intended to be used by penetration testers, its resources may aid manufacturers and operators of IoT devices to proactively improve the security of their devices.
